CXO Capability Lead
We are looking for a passionate and experienced
Capability Lead
to drive enterprise-wide excellence among our
Product Ownership (CXO)
community through capability building initiatives and driving consistency and measurable growth.
Key Responsibilities
Capability Building :
Develop and implement structured frameworks, resources and learning pathways to support the growth and performance of CXO (Product Owners) and CXLs (CXO Leads).
Performance Tracking :
Ensure consistency and measurable uplift in CXO effectiveness and maturity across the enterprise.
Stakeholder Engagement :
Build and maintain excellent relationships by partnering with leadership teams to ensure CXO / CXL's are empowered and able to deliver business value.
Continuous Improvement :
Identify gaps and implement strategies to support and train individuals through fostering a community of excellence
What Do I Need to Be Successful?
Deep expertise in Agile Product and Customer Experience ownership with a proven track record in complex environments.
Previous success in coaching and driving capability uplift with the ability to build confidence and skill across a diverse group of individuals.
Experience in designing and executing learning pathways, frameworks, and development plans.
Excellent stakeholder engagement and influencing skills across multiple business areas and levels
Illustration of deep knowledge in agile delivery, particularly within a product / experience ownership environment.
